'TOBESOFT' and 'Micro Focus' Hold Developer Seminar

TOBESOFT and Micro Focus Hold Developer Seminar
 
- Collaboration between the two companies leads to easier updating of existing enterprise systems using the latest platform.
- Technology sharing and supplementation creates new system migration methods, developer training follows.

Multinational software company Micro Focus (www.microfocus.co.kr), the developer and supplier of Visual COBOL, and TOBESOFT (Hyeong-gon Kim, Yong-ho Choi, Co-CEOs; www.tobesoft.co.kr), the 'Business UI/UX' specialist, recently held a two-day 'Visual COBOL for Eclipse Development Seminar' for developers at the TOBESOFT headquarters from the 22nd of October.
 
The seminar introduced a new method for migrating[1] existing enterprise system applications using Micro Focus' Visual COBOL and TOBESOFT's nexacro platform and X-UP. This method is a fast way to build an application by converting an existing legacy system into an advanced system, utilizing the latest IT architecture to increase efficiency similar to mobile and cloud solutions.
 
"Through this seminar, we were able to show developers the innovative ways in which enterprise applications could be automatically converted using technologies developed collaboratively between the two companies," said TOBESOFT CEO Hyeong-gon Kim. "If applications developed through Micro Focus' Visual COBOL and TOBESOFT's Nexacro Platform and X-UP are able to gain success and recognition in South Korea, we will strongly consider future entry into European and South American markets."
 
Speaking about the advantages of the new method, Micro Focus Korea's Regional Manager I-deun Kim stated, "Micro Focus' Visual COBOL is a product that is widely used in enterprises throughout the world. By combining TOBESOFT's technologies with Visual COBOL, we can maintain the benefits of legacy systems while reducing systems building costs and time. Better development productivity is a certainty."
 
In January 2015, Micro Focus and TOBESOFT signed an agreement to collaborate in utilizing and developing leading standard technologies that enable systems modernization so that customers can respond quickly and flexibly to market changes and minimize costs and risk while at the same time preserving the intrinsic value of existing enterprise systems.


[1]Migration: Refers to the transition from a legacy system environment to the latest environment.
 
 
[Micro Focus]
Based out of England, Micro Focus is a software and IT business that supplies essential enterprise applications to numerous companies and has a firm presence in the global market with over 90 of the world's top 100 enterprises using its products.
With Visual COBOL as its primary product, Micro Focus' product line is able to respond quickly to market shifts and facilitate the use of modern software architecture while reducing the costs and risks of customers' enterprise applications.
The company boasts more than 30 years of accumulated technologies with over two million licensed users and 18,000 customers. It continues to actively expand its scope of business, including the recent acquisition of Borland (www.borland.com), an enterprise performance management solutions provider.
